I used MTEC 4300K bulbs for my foglights. The bulb size is H8. I used it because it has lifetime warranty and much cheaper than PIAA. You should definitely try to use a brand that's reputable. I used some cheap brands before (Eurolights) and the bulb exploded multiple times. It wasn't fun taking the headlight housing apart cleaning all the shattered glass.

Okay, I don't know how the others did it with the H11's, but it didn't fit for me... they look identical at first glance, but a closer look showed a slight difference... so now, I'm waiting for Hoen to replace the bulb since it was THEM who told me to buy H11's... lol! So yeah, H8's are the way to go guys!
